Output af760adcd74ae30cd350792f0387232f17ff5400c2b9f60fbc1b82eec433e38a:5

value
105618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b5523f40cbe1c1baaa98fef396dca1a8d1d32e OP_EQUAL
address
3JAWmVkNHFXfWkzT6iPGy8MLBkPFYXK5L2
transaction
af760adcd74ae30cd350792f0387232f17ff5400c2b9f60fbc1b82eec433e38a
spent
true